4. MIDI Volume Control
________________________________________________________
4.1 Connections for the Volume Control
To use the volume control, you must "patch" it into your signal path. There are no internal audio
connections to or from the MIDI volume control. The volume control can be used for stereo
volume, panning, or two separate mono volumes depending on your connections and the type of
MIDI commands sent to it.
•
Stereo volume control:
Connect the left and right outputs of your source to the left and
right inputs of the volume control. The two volume control outputs are then connected to
the next device in the system.
•
Mono volume control:
Using the left inputs and outputs, connect the volume control
just like a normal volume pedal.
•
Dual mono volume control:
Connect the left and right volume control input/output
jacks independently.
•
Stereo pan control:
Connect the mono output of your source to the left volume control
input. Then connect the left
and
right volume control outputs to the next device in the
system.
To use the MIDI volume control in your System Mix Plus, you also need to plug something into
the MIDI IN jack on the rear panel that can send the appropriate MIDI commands. You have two
choices: 1) Digital Music Corporation's Ground Control or 2) something other than Ground
Control.

4.3 Using the Volume Control without Ground Control
The System Mix Plus Volume Control responds to Continuous Controller messages on MIDI
Channel 16. The VCA responds to the following Continuous Controller commands:
007 - Stereo Volume
010 - Pan
012 - Left Volume
013 - Right Volume
